Title :
High-index-contrast single output teardrop laser fabricated via oxygen-enhanced non-selective oxidation

Abstract :
A high-index-contrast single output teardrop laser fabricated via oxygen-enhanced non-selective wet oxidation is demonstrated. The device offers a low (55 mA) threshold and high (138 mW) output power from a single, uncoated output facet.
